2) OVEREXPANSION
Rome grew way too large
They had a hard time controlling military and their people
Very unorganized of how they spent their money
This is 2nd on the list because overexpansion does effect how a country runs
Photo by
mohammadali
4.
1) INVASIONS
German tribes invaded the West
Sassanid Persians invaded the East
They were losing money
Economy issues were raising
This is 1st on the list because their country can be destroyed by these invasions
